Transaction 86afffb6185965623abf39249bb2374344cf573b11587cb4f92aad3f748cb913

1 Input
2 Outputs
  • 86afffb6185965623abf39249bb2374344cf573b11587cb4f92aad3f748cb913:0
  • value  1686839
    address  18qEUa2gtfPQr7MoowBrwmLoZBPHjHQ9Bn
  • 86afffb6185965623abf39249bb2374344cf573b11587cb4f92aad3f748cb913:1
  • value  9214214
    address  1CCer3z9kLDQSfP6SYY48mUcZ3oDy8M83x